Cora's voice weaves through tragedy, revealing her jaded perspective as an affluent Manhattan teen. Her recollections form a delicate tapestry of loss and resilience.
As Cora grapples with her solitude in post-9/11 New York, her reflections on her mother’s death reveal her complex emotional landscape, heavy with grief and longing.
The novel elegantly traverses time, connecting Cora’s present struggles with past family secrets and traumas, showcasing the intertwined fates of the women in her lineage.
Confessions delves into significant societal issues, such as addiction and mental illness, as it narrates the journey of Cora's family across decades, highlighting their hidden battles.
